An Approach to Simulation of Extreme Conditions for a Planetary Lander | |
Queen, Eric M.; Striepe, Scott A.; Powell, Richard W. | |
英文摘要 | A "Monte Carlo-like" design analysis tool is developed and applied to an aeromaneuvering Mars entry vehicle. This tool provides realistic but challenging design cases using many fewer cases than a full Monte Carlo analysis. The problem of random input variables that are provided a priori (as opposed to being drawn from a given distribution) is addressed and a solution is found that shows prospects for future improvement. |
